An Interdisciplinary and Inter-cultural Conference
Sponsored by the
The Americas Council and the
Office of International Education for the University System of Georgia
The Americas Council provides an annual conference for presenters and participants to explore critical socio-cultural, political, economic, global, regional and national issues including the challenges and opportunities facing Latin America, the Caribbean and Canada. Proposals for individual papers and panels on specific topics are now being requested.
While the focus of this conference is primarily for university/college faculty members, the Americas Council also encourages secondary school faculty along with graduate and undergraduate students to participate. The conference typically includes at least two graduate and two undergraduate panels.
